The Deer Hash Recipe

Deer hash is a delicious and hearty dish that can be enjoyed as a main course or side. The flavor of deer hash is quite unique and is a result of the combination of ingredients used. The base of the dish is ground deer meat, which is cooked with onions, carrots, celery, garlic, and spices. The vegetables add a sweetness to the dish, while the spices add an earthy, slightly spicy flavor. The end result is a savory, comforting dish that pairs perfectly with mashed potatoes or biscuits.

Ingredients:

  • 2 lbs. ground venison (or ground beef)
  • 1 large on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 green b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 red b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 jalapeno pepper, minced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on cumin
  • 1/2 teaspoon oregano
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1/4 cup chicken broth
  • 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ped

Instructions:

  1.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
  2. Add the venison, onion, garlic, bell peppers, and jalapeno pepper.
  3. Cook, stirring constantly, until the meat is browned and the vegetables are softened, about 8 minutes.
  4. Add the salt, pepper, paprika, cumin, oregano, and cayenne pepper.
  5. Cook, stirring constantly, for 1 minute.
  6. Add the chicken broth and Worcestershire sauce and bring to a simmer.
  7. Simmer for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the sauce has thickened.
  8. Stir in the parsley and serve.

What Does Deer Hash Taste Like?

The taste of deer hash is slightly sweet and savory, with a slightly gamey flavor. It is a hearty, filling dish that can be served either as a main meal or as a side. The texture of the deer hash is slightly chunky, and the peppers and onions provide a crunchy contrast to the tenderness of the deer meat. The overall flavor of the dish is slightly sweet and savory, with a hint of earthiness from the deer meat.

Is Deer Hash Healthy?

Deer hash is considered to be healthy as it is low in fat, high in protein, and contains many essential vitamins and minerals. It also provides a good source of iron, zinc, potassium, magnesium, and phosphorus. Deer meat is packed with essential fatty acids and has a high concentration of B vitamins, which are important for healthy cell metabolism.

When prepared properly, deer hash is an easy and nutritious meal that can be enjoyed as a main dish or as a side. Deer hash can be made with either fresh or frozen venison, mixed with other ingredients such as vegetables and spices. It can also be served with potatoes, pasta, or rice.
